以两台主机为例,host1:192.168.2.178 host2 192.168.2.179
1,jboss安装,略。
2,修改文件
host1:
${JBOSS_HOME}/server/all/deploy/cluster/jgroups-channelfactory.sar/META-INF/jgroups-channelfactory-stacks.xml
修改如下两处
<TCPPING timeout="3000"
initial_hosts="{192.168.2.179[7600],192.168.2.178[7600]}"
port_range="1"
num_initial_members="3"/>
<TCPPING timeout="3000"
initial_hosts="{192.168.2.178[7600],192.168.2.179[7600]}"
port_range="1"
num_initial_members="3"/>
(注意jboss上面两处默认是注释掉得,需要打开。)
这两处的initial_hosts顺序正好相反
host2:
initial_hosts顺序反过来即可。
3,修改文件
host1:
${JBOSS_HOME}/server/all/deploy/jbossweb.sar/server.xml
<Engine...加上jvmRoute="server1"
host2:jvmRoute="server2"
4,jboss启动
./run.sh -c all -b 192.168.2.178
./run.sh -c all -b 192.168.2.179
如上,后面需要加上host
5,apache配置:jk略